java enum 代码
当我们在Java中使用enum时,我们可以定义一个enum类型,然后在代码中使用它。以下是一个简单的例子:
java.
public class EnumExample {。
// 定义一个enum类型。
public enum Day {。
switch语句具体例子 MONDAY, TUESDAY, WEDNESDAY, THURSDAY, FRIDAY, SATURDAY, SUNDAY.
}。
public static void main(String[] args) {。
// 使用enum类型。
Day today = Day.MONDAY;
System.out.println("Today is " + today);
// 使用switch语句处理enum.
switch (today) {。
case MONDAY:
System.out.println("It's Monday");
break;
case TUESDAY:
System.out.println("It's Tuesday");
break;
// 其他case省略。
}。
// 遍历enum中的所有值。
System.out.println("All days of the week:");
for (Day day : Day.values()) {。
System.out.println(day);
}。
}。
}。
在上面的例子中,我们首先定义了一个enum类型Day,它包含了一周中的每一天。然后在main方法中,我们创建了一个Day类型的变量today,并将其赋值为Day.MONDAY。我们展示了如何使用switch语句处理enum类型,以及如何遍历enum中的所有值。
除了上面的例子外,enum还可以有构造函数、方法和字段,使其更加灵活和强大。在实际开发中,enum经常用于表示一组相关的常量,例如颜、状态、类型等。使用enum可以提高代码的可读性和可维护性。
希望这个例子能够帮助你更好地理解在Java中如何使用enum。如果你有任何其他关于enum的问题,也欢迎继续提问。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论